PURPOSE: To improve the acclerating performance of a diesel engine, by increasing fuel supply in response to the output signal produced when the depth of depression on the accelerating pedal has exceeded a preset reference value.
CONSTITUTION: Output voltage of a potentiometer 1 attached to a control lever of a fuel injection pump coaxially therewith is proportional to the depth of depression of the acclerator pedal and the voltage is applied directly to the non- inverted side of a differential amplifier 2. Further, the voltage produced by passing the output voltage of the potentiometer 1 through a delay circuit consisting of a resistance R and a capacitor C is applied to the inverted side of the differential amplifier 2, and the differential voltage is compared with a preset reference value at a comparator 3. With such an arrangement, when the output of the differential amplifier 2 becomes higher than the reference value, a transistor 4 is turned ON and a solenoid valve 5 is opened to introduce negative pressure from a vacuum pump 6 into a vacuum chamber 71 of a vacuum actuator 7. Resultantly, a rod 8 of the vacuum actuator 7 is moved to the left in the drawing, so that fuel supply is increased.
